“…Therefore, imbalances in the gut microbiota can lead to common metabolic diseases including fatty liver, diabetes, oxidative damage, and inflammatory responses, which negatively affect the growth and development of fish. In contrast, the modulation of the gut microbiota with supplements such as probiotics can be an excellent strategy to increase fish growth and immunity in aquaculture (Cicala et al, 2020;Fan and Pedersen, 2021;Jang et al, 2021a;Wastyk et al, 2021;Bruni et al, 2022;Gao et al, 2022).…”
